NEW RELIGION AND ETHICS DISCUSSION KITS AVAILABLE
RELIGION AND ETHICS NEWSWEEKLY, airing each Saturday at 2:30/1:30 p.m. MT/PT, examines current events and public affairs from a religious and ethical point of view, providing an opportunity for fascinating and provocative discussion. IdahoPTV is pleased to be able to offer discussion groups an outreach kit that contains video clips from the series that can be used to frame a discussion. A discussion leader's guide provides insights, additional resources, and tips on hosting successful, non-confrontational discussions.
This year's outreach kit features video clips from four topic areas. Saving Lives, Saving Souls covers parish nursing and a church health center where doctors and nurses donate skills and time. Religion & Public Schools looks at the realities of first amendment issues and the study of religions in public school classrooms, hosted by Charles Haynes of the Freedom Forum. When the Faithful Lose Faith in Marriage covers Single Moms by Choice, same-sex unions, spousal abuse, and cohabitation. Whose God? Who's God? explores various views of God in our increasingly diverse religious society.
There are many models for events based on this thought-provoking series, ranging from panelists debating local issues in a global context, to large groups which view video segments and hear presentations on a topic, then break into small discussion groups, to Bible study groups considering and discussing issues of concern in our modern society.
